White water, the water recycled in the papermaking process, often contains a complex mixture of fibers, fillers, chemicals, and dissolved solids, making it prone to foaming. Effective management of foam in white water systems is crucial for maintaining process efficiency, optimizing water usage, and ensuring the quality of the final paper product. Foam in white water can disrupt the formation of the paper sheet, leading to inconsistencies and defects. It can also hinder the efficiency of deaeration equipment and contribute to slime formation if not properly controlled. The presence of dissolved air and surfactants in white water necessitates the use of potent defoaming agents. Silicone-based defoamers are particularly effective in these scenarios due to their ability to quickly reduce surface tension and break stable foam structures. Their non-ionic nature also ensures good compatibility with the various chemical components typically found in white water.
